CS 120 Introduction to OOP Class 09 – Java arrays Fill.java • Write a Java program that creates several int arrays of a specified size and fills them as follows: • • • • With zeros With ones With successive values in ascending order With successive values in descending order console input import java.util.Scanner; public class Fill { public static void main(String[] args) { Scanner input = new Scanner(System.in); } } reading int from input import java.util.Scanner; public class Fill { public static void main(String[] args) { Scanner input = new Scanner(System.in); int size = input.nextInt(); } } declaring array import java.util.Scanner; public class Fill { public static void main(String[] args) { Scanner input = new Scanner(System.in); int size = input.nextInt(); int zeros[]; // reference to array } } creating array import java.util.Scanner; public class Fill { public static void main(String[] args) { Scanner input = new Scanner(System.in); int size = input.nextInt(); int zeros[]; // reference to array zeros = new int[size]; // array as object } } printing array elements import java.util.Scanner; public class Fill { public static void main(String[] args) { Scanner input = new Scanner(System.in); int size = input.nextInt(); int zeros[]; zeros = new int[size]; // By default, elements initialized to 0 for (int i = 0; i < zeros.length; i++) System.out.print(zeros[i] + " "); System.out.println(); } } creating another array of same size import java.util.Scanner; public class Fill { public static void main(String[] args) { // continuation int ones[] = new int[zeros.length]; } } filling array with 1 import java.util.Scanner; public class Fill { public static void main(String[] args) { // continuation int ones[] = new int[zeros.length]; for (int i = 0; i < ones.length; i++) ones[i] = 1; } } printing array import java.util.Scanner; public class Fill { public static void main(String[] args) { // continuation int ones[] = new int[zeros.length]; for (int i = 0; i < ones.length; i++) ones[i] = 1; for (int i = 0; i < ones.length; i++) System.out.print(ones[i] + " "); System.out.println(); } } filling array in ascending order import java.util.Scanner; public class Fill { public static void main(String[] args) { // continuation int straight[] = new int[zeros.length]; for (int i = 0; i < straight.length; i++) straight[i] = i; for (int i = 0; i < straight.length; i++) System.out.print(straight[i] + " "); System.out.println(); } } filling array in descending order import java.util.Scanner; public class Fill { public static void main(String[] args) { // continuation int reverse[] = new int[zeros.length]; for (int i = 0; i < reverse.length; i++) reverse[i] = reverse.length – i - 1; for (int i = 0; i < reverse.length; i++) System.out.print(reverse[i] + " "); System.out.println(); } }
